Girish Posted September 27, 2009 Share Posted September 27, 2009 i dont have any xliveless. Download it from here: http://www.gtaforums.com/index.php?showtopic=388658 Copy the "xlive.dll" file to your GTA IV folder. Then, copy your saves to the new location: (for Windows Vista) %USERPROFILE%\Documents\Rockstar Games\GTA IV\savegames\ (for Windows XP) %USERPROFILE%\My Documents\Rockstar Games\GTA IV\savegames\ Now, start the game.
